Tanzania - Export of Transistors, Except Photosensitive with a Dissipation Rate of 1 Watt and More
Since 2013, Tanzania Export of Transistors, Except Photosensitive with a Dissipation Rate of 1 Watt and More fell by 62.6% year on year. With $280.43 in 2018, the country was number 94 comparing other countries in Export of Transistors, Except Photosensitive with a Dissipation Rate of 1 Watt and More. Tanzania is overtaken by Ecuador, which was ranked number 93 with $311.49 and is followed by Mauritius at $278. China ranked the highest with $3,654,076,472.77 in 2019, an increase of 3.2% compared to 2018. Singapore, Germany and Japan resp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Fiji recorded the best 5 years average growth at +131.3% per year, while Malta was the worst growing country at -74.3% per year.
